git 刪除已經 add 的檔案

2022-07-20 12:15:14 字數 560 閱讀 6131

使用git rm命令即可,有兩種選擇,

一種是git rm --cached "檔案路徑",不刪除物理檔案,僅將該檔案從快取中刪除;

一種是git rm --f "檔案路徑",不僅將該檔案從快取中刪除,還會將物理檔案刪除(不會**到垃圾桶)。

建立目錄mkdir

建立檔案touch

linux 刪除目錄很簡單,很多人還是習慣用rmdir,不過一旦目錄非空,就陷入深深的苦惱之中……

直接rm就可以了,不過要加兩個引數-rf即:

rm -rf 「目錄名字」

-r就是向下遞迴,不管有多少級目錄,一併刪除

-f就是直接強行刪除,不作任何提示的意思

的時候一定要格外小心,linux 沒有**站的

git 只add後reset,找add的檔案

手賤操作 git reset hard sha1恢復時,把add的內容直接覆蓋掉,找不到 了。因為只有add,git reflog無用,git fsck lost found 裡邊也找不到個啥。ps 至今未找到.git lost found other 資料夾在哪。真的奇了怪了。恢復方法 find ...

git如何刪除已經提交的檔案或資料夾

在github上只能刪除倉庫,卻無法刪除資料夾或檔案,所以只能通過命令來解決 首先進入你的master資料夾下,git bash here 開啟命令視窗 git help 幫助命令 git pull origin master 將遠端倉庫裡面的專案拉下來 dir 檢視有哪些資料夾 git rm r ...

idea 新增的檔案使用git不能add

原因是 git 配置了本地的gitignore的檔案 問題解決 首先我們可以通過命令檢視全域性配置中是否有呼叫外部 非工程下 的gitignore檔案 git config l 1例如core.excluedesfile 這一項 如果發現如上圖中,有關於全域性gitignore的配置項,說明就是這個...